TypicalApplications Machinability/Formability Used where higher mechanical properties than 410 are required and where corrosive conditions are not too severe. Typically: valve parts, centrifuge bowls, chemical equipment, bolts and screws, in aerospace, defence and high technology markets. ProductDescription S80 is a 16% chromium stainless steel modified by the addition of nickel, in the British Standard Aerospace series of alloys. It is designed to develop high mechanical properties by conventional heat treatment methods and provide good corrosion resistance. This grade is manufactured by electric melting process. It is magnetic in all conditions and can therefore be used for parts which may be subject to magnetic inspection. The designation S80D denotes material in the hardened and tempered condition. BSS80hasbettermachiningcharacteristicsthanthe chromium-nickelgrades.Ithasamachinabilityratingof 45%,with1212rated100%.Surfacecuttingspeedon automaticscrewmachinesisapproximately75ft/min. Thismaterialcanbecoldformed.Ifacoldforming operationisundertakenthenastressrelievingtreatment shouldbeapplied. StainlessSteelBar CorrosionResistance The corrosion resistance of BS S80 is superior to that of the standard chromium grades such as Types 410 and 416. This grade has excellent resistance to corrosion in all conditions of heat treatment from mild acids and alkalis, neutral and basic salts, food acids, and atmosphere. Maximum resistance is obtained by hardening and polishing. Weldability May be welded by all the commercial processes except forge or hammer welding. Large sections should be preheated prior to welding. Because of air-hardening properties, this grade should be annealed after welding. RelatedSpecifications
